Domen Škofic (born April 11, 1994) is a Slovenian rock climber who specializes in competition climbing and also outdoor sport climbing. In 2016, he won the IFSC Climbing World Cup in competition lead climbing.

7.0On September 20, 2023, Jakob Schubert was able to climb “B.I.G.” (formerly known as “Project Big”) in Flatanger, Norway—one of the most demanding sport climbing routes in the world. Originally bolted by Adam Ondra, the route remained a project for over a decade. After working on it together in 2022, Jakob returned the following year with a new idea: attempting the climb while livestreaming my tries. “B.I.G. – A World First” documents this journey—capturing not only the ascent itself, but also the mental side of pushing Jakob’s limits on a route that once felt impossible.
